Disk Space Requirement

The hard disk requirements computation for Active Directory Auditing & File Server Auditing are detailed in the tables below. The numbers reached are with a simple calculation based on the number of users, number of days and the approx size of an event log.

Active Directory Auditing

Number of Users

Number of Days

Total Size

1 1 15 KB
10000 90 15 * 10000 * 90 = 13500000 KB (13 GB)

For example, let us imagine the below scenario:

No of Domain Controllers : 5

No of users : 10000

No of Days : 90

Average log size : 15 KB

Disc Space : Average Log Size * No of Users * No of Days

    : 15 kb * 10000 * 90 = 13500000 (12.8 GB)

Archive : (Average Log Size * No of Users * No of Days) / 10

    : (12.8 GB) / 10

As the 'Archived' logs will be zipped, the folder size will reduce by 90%, making the zipping ratio as 10:1.

Total Disc Space = Archive (1.28 GB) + 12.8 GB (Approx for 15 kb * 10000 Users * 90)

File Server Auditing

Number of Users

Number of Files

Number of Days

Total Size

1 1 1 4 KB
100 1 1 400 KB
100 100 1 40000 KB (40 MB)
100 100 90 40000 * 90 = 3.5 GB
100 100 720 (2 yrs) 40000 * 720 = 29 GB

Disc Space : Average Log Size * No of Users * No of Files * No of Days

Archive : (Average Log Size * No of Users * No of Files * No of Days) / 10

As the 'Archived' logs will be zipped, the folder size will reduce by 90%, making the zipping ratio as 10:1.

Total Disc Space = Archive + Disk Space

Tips to keep disk space on check

Disk Space Alerts

An administrator can configure a threshold value for free disc space. When the free space on the Server goes below the threshold, an alert will be sent to the configured email address.

i. Check size of ev_temp & temp folder & ensure it is empty or having very few files.

ii. Check logs folder size is not more than 1 GB.

Data Archiving

Data archiving in ADAudit Plus allows organizations to archive processed audit data to an archive folder by compressing the files to a zip format at the intervals mentioned, ensuring forensic and compliance requirements. The 'days' (in the image below) refers to the number of days the event log data is stored in the Active Database, which will later be archived based on the 'Archive Events' under Admin tab.
